instance method
unique_constraint
Ruby on Rails 8.1.2
Since v7.1.6Signature
unique_constraint(...)
Adds a unique constraint.
t.unique_constraint(:position, name: 'unique_position', deferrable: :deferred, nulls_not_distinct: true)
Parameters
-
...req
Source
# File activerecord/lib/active_record/connection_adapters/postgresql/schema_definitions.rb, line 316
def unique_constraint(...)
@base.add_unique_constraint(name, ...)
end
Defined in activerecord/lib/active_record/connection_adapters/postgresql/schema_definitions.rb line 316
· View on GitHub
· Improve this page
· Find usages on GitHub
Defined in ActiveRecord::ConnectionAdapters::PostgreSQL::Table